J. Kühl is a scholar working on Immunology, Molecular Biology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, J. Kühl has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 333 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Immunology, 2 papers in Molecular Biology and 2 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in J. Kühl's work include Virus-based gene therapy research (2 papers),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(2 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(2 papers). J. Kühl is often cited by papers focused on Virus-based gene therapy research (2 papers),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(2 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(2 papers). J. Kühl coll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Austria. J. Kühl's co-authors include S.Ž. Pavletić, H Bertz, S. J. Lee, Daniel Wolff, Ingo Kleiter, H. Greinix, Oliver Grauer, Ánita Lawitschka, Branimir I. Šikić and Wolfram Ebell and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, Brain and JNCI Journal of the National Cancer Institute.
